Dr. R. R. Ambi earned his Ph.D. in Physics from Shivaji University, Kolhapur (2024) π and currently serves as an Assistant Professor at Jaysingpur College, Jaysingpur ποΈ. He was awarded the MJSRF-2021 Senior Research Fellowship by MAHAJYOTI, Nagpur, recognizing his research excellence π. He completed his M.Sc. in Physics from Shivaji University (2018). His research focuses on the synthesis of binary, ternary, and composite nanocrystalline metal oxide thin films π§ͺ, with applications in solar cells, gas sensors, and supercapacitors β‘.
